Bible Verses for a Blessed Thursday Afternoon
For Christian readers, Scripture can give a Thursday afternoon message greater depth. Bible verses about peace, strength, gratitude, trust, and God’s care fit naturally with afternoon reflection. One familiar example is Philippians 4:6–7, which points readers toward prayer instead of anxiety and describes God’s peace as something that can guard the heart and mind. Another meaningful passage is Isaiah 41:10, which offers reassurance about God’s presence and strength during difficult moments.
Psalm 46:10 is also a powerful choice for a quiet afternoon: “Be still, and know that I am God.” The verse encourages stillness in a world that often rewards constant activity. Proverbs 3:5–6 speaks about trusting God rather than relying only on personal understanding, while Psalm 121 emphasizes God’s watchful care. These passages can turn Thursday afternoon prayers and blessings into moments of reflection rather than simply words sent through a phone. When using Scripture, include the reference so readers can explore the wider context and reflect on the passage themselves.
| Bible passage | Thursday afternoon theme | Reflection |
| Philippians 4:6–7 | Peace during worry | Bring your concerns to God through prayer and trust. |
| Isaiah 41:10 | Strength and courage | Remember that you don’t face difficult moments alone. |
| Psalm 46:10 | Stillness and faith | Take a quiet moment to slow down and recognize God’s presence. |
| Proverbs 3:5–6 | Guidance | Trust God while making decisions about the road ahead. |
| Psalm 121 | Protection | Reflect on God’s care throughout the day and night. |
| Psalm 23 | Comfort and guidance | Remember God’s presence through peaceful and difficult seasons. |
